As 2025 unfolds, digital nomadism is no longer a niche lifestyle but a growing global trend, reshaping work and life dynamics in ways previously unimaginable. The convergence of rapid technological advances and the evolving global economic landscape has helped transform the notion of work, allowing individuals to break free from traditional office settings.
In recent years, the word "digital nomad" has become synonymous with flexibility, freedom, and a work-life balance. This trend, driven by advancements in connectivity and remote work tools, has enabled professionals to work from anywhere in the world. Moreover, the desire for more experiential lifestyles among younger generations has fueled the growth of nomadic communities across the globe.
Key to this transformation is the unprecedented advancement in digital technologies that facilitate seamless communication and collaboration across borders. Tools such as virtual meeting platforms, cloud-based services, and collaboration software have erased geographic boundaries, enabling teams to work effectively, regardless of their location. This has not only increased productivity but also offered businesses access to a wider talent pool.
Economically, regions previously considered off the beaten path have started to attract remote workers, boosting local economies. Countries like Portugal, Thailand, and Mexico have become hotspots for digital nomads, offering incentives such as digital nomad visas and tax breaks to encourage remote workers to relocate. In turn, the influx of digital nomads has catalyzed the development of co-working spaces and other infrastructures, revitalizing local economies and fostering a more vibrant cultural exchange.
Nevertheless, this shift is not without challenges. As countries navigate the burgeoning digital nomad trend, issues around taxation, internet security, and the digital divide must be addressed. Policymakers are tasked with ensuring that their regulations personify the ideal balance between facilitating this new lifestyle and securing the interests of their citizens.
The lifestyle is also reshaping urban landscapes, with cities adapting to meet the demands of a transient population. From increased demand for short-term housing to the proliferation of cafes doubling as workspaces, urban planning is progressively accommodating this demographic's needs.
